
Nigerian Woman Reacts to Frank Edoho Controversy, Advises Men to Consider DNA Tests
A Nigerian woman has triggered intense reactions on social media after sharing her opinion on the ongoing controversy surrounding media personality Frank Edoho and conversations about infidelity in marriage.
The woman drew attention online after advising men to consider conducting DNA tests on their children if their wives openly support cheating by women in relationships. Her statement reportedly came amid heated online debates connected to comments involving Frank Edoho’s marriage and discussions about infidelity.
“If your wife is supporting Frank Edoho’s wife for cheating, you should consider doing DNA tests on your children,” the woman reportedly stated in a post that quickly spread across multiple social media platforms.
Her comments immediately sparked widespread debate online, with users expressing sharply divided opinions over the controversial statement. Some social media users agreed with her perspective, arguing that people who defend infidelity may encourage distrust and unhealthy values within relationships.
Others, however, strongly criticized the statement, describing it as unfair, provocative, and capable of creating unnecessary suspicion within marriages and families.
